
My drawing A Tribute to Artie Schaefer remembers the polka and joy that Artie Schaefer brought to audiences through out his life. His portrait is based off a 1965 photo of him as a young man. I placed him in front of the Gasthaus Bavarian Hunter as it looked near the time he established the Artie Schaefer Band. Artie drummed his way through more than 2,000 country and western and polka music gigs, at the same time balancing his work as an insurance agent and county commissioner. He shared polka and waltzes and chicken dances with crowds at the Gasthaus for over three decades.
